text: Schloss Neidstein is a castle located in the Upper Palatinate in Bavaria, Germany, in the municipality of Etzelwang. It was the seat of a Hofmark during the Palatinate-Sulzbach period. The castle, with its 165 hectares of forest and meadows, is now part of the Schergenbuck reserve. Neidstein was the residence of the Brandt family since 1466.
